Zion Suzuki Shines in Premier League Win at Tottenham

· Sports · BBC Sport

Goalkeeper Zion Suzuki delivered a standout performance to help Aston Villa secure their first Premier League win of the season with a victory over Tottenham at Tottenham Hotspur Stadium. The 24-year-old Japan international, signed from Italian club Parma for approximately £30m in August, made crucial saves to deny Savio during a period of sustained pressure from the hosts. Suzuki also initiated the play for Villa's second goal with a long clearance from his own six-yard box that Nicolas Jackson collected and converted. Villa manager Unai Emery praised the goalkeeper's distribution and shot-stopping abilities following the match. Suzuki has earned 28 international caps and previously played in Japan, Belgium, and Italy.

Why it matters

Suzuki's strong debut performance indicates that Aston Villa has successfully filled the gap left by Emiliano Martinez's departure to Chelsea, strengthening the club's defensive stability for the Premier League season.
